Abstract

Triaryl-methane dyestuffs which are free from sulfonic acid and carboxylic acid groups and are selected from the group consisting of dyestuffs having one of the following four formulae: ##STR1## wherein R is alkyl, aralkyl, cycloalkyl or aryl; R.sub.1 is hydrogen, alkyl, aralkyl or cycloalkyl; R.sub.2 is alkyl, aralkyl, cycloalkyl or aryl; R.sub.1 and R.sub.2 additionally including divalent alkylene when joined together with the nitrogen or with a carbon atom in the o-position in the ring A to form a heterocyclic ring; R.sub.3 is hydrogen, alkyl, aralkyl, aryl, aralkoxy, aryloxy, halogen, carboxylic acid ester radical, carbonamido, sulfonamido, cyano, nitro, alkylsulfonyl, aryalkylsulfonyl, arylsulfonyl or acyl; and X is the radical of an anion; ##STR2## wherein R is alkyl or cycloalkyl; R.sub.1 is hydrogen, alkyl, aralkyl, cycloalkyl or aryl; R.sub.2 is alkyl, cycloalkyl, aralkyl or aryl, halogen or cyano; R.sub.1 and R.sub.2 additionally include divalent alkylene when joined together with the nitrogen atom or with a carbon atom in the o-position in the ring A to form a heterocyclic ring; R.sub.3 is hydrogen or alkyl; R.sub.4 is alkyl or cycloalkyl; and X is the radical of an anion; ##STR3## wherein R is alkyl or cycloalkyl; R.sub.1 is hydrogen or methyl; R.sub.2 is methyl, aryl, or cycloalkyl; R.sub.3 is hydrogen or alkyl; R.sub.4 is alkyl or cycloalkyl; R.sub.3 and R.sub.4 additionally include divalent alkylene when joined together to form a carbocyclic ring; and X is the radical of an anion; and ##STR4## wherein at least one R is halogen, alkyl, or alkoxy and the other R's are hydrogen, halogen, alkyl, or alkoxy; R.sub.1 is hydrogen or methyl; R.sub.2 is methyl, aryl, or cycloalkyl; and X is the radical of an anion. Process of preparing the above dyestuffs by condensation of an appropriate benzophenone with an aromatic amine or by the oxidation of the corresponding leuco compound. These dyestuffs are particularly useful in dyeing or printing materials made of polymers of acrylonitrile, polymers of as.-dicyanoethylene, and acid-modified aromatic polyesters.
